All ammunition in Factorio has a setting 'target_type', which is normally set to 'entity' making the weapon target entities, like the machine gun, or the normal rockets do.
Some have 'direction', such as the cannon shell, which goes in a given direction up to its maximum range.
Some have 'position' which means they attempt to fire at the mouse. This is the case for the atomic bomb, and is why it can be fired at the ground.

TL;DR:
The atomic rocket fires at the mouse, rather than auto-targetting enemies like other weapons do.
This means that it can easily be fired with the space key.

Am I reading this right? Do I need 9 rocket silos to achieve 3000spm? I have the right amount of resources created (I think) but I feel that I can't sustain 9 silos.

Re: Simple Questions and Short Answers

Posted: Fri Jan 15, 2021 5:44 pm
by torne
LancelotSwe wrote:
Fri Jan 15, 2021 4:28 pm
https://imgur.com/KZX2ypz

Am I reading this right? Do I need 9 rocket silos to achieve 3000spm? I have the right amount of resources created (I think) but I feel that I can't sustain 9 silos.
You are reading this right; with 4 prod 3's and only four speed 3 modules (i.e. two beacons) affecting each silo, yes, you need 9.8 silos (so 10 really, just you can afford a little bit of downtime). If this seems like a lot, remember that it takes over 40 seconds for the rocket launch animation to happen, during which it's not producing rocket parts, so to launch three rockets a minute you need either a lot of silos or a lot of speed beacons :)

LancelotSwe wrote:
Fri Jan 15, 2021 10:45 pm
But can 35 units/s of LDS, Rocket Control Units and rocket fuel sustain 9 silos.
Yes; the calculator is correct. To break it down a bit:

- Target is 50 space science per second. You get 1000 space science from launching each rocket, and each rocket requires 100 rocket parts. So, you need to build 5 rocket parts per second in total across all the silos.
- Each rocket part takes 10 LDS, 10 RCU, 10 rocket fuel, so that would be 50/s of each, except that with four productivity 3 modules in the silo you are getting 40% extra rocket parts for free, so the actual input required is only 50 / 1.4 = 35.714 per second.

The number of silos isn't involved in the calculation of the resources required; the silos just need to be fast enough to *consume* those resources.
Or maybe I have to few beacons, I have 10 beacons around every silo, that 20 speed mods right. So now I'm down to 4, I think.
My first megabase =D
"Too few" beacons doesn't really mean much here - it's just a tradeoff between number of silos and number of beacons per silo. With 10 beacons on each silo you need 4.1 silos as the calculator says; to use only 4 you would need 11 beacons (22 speed 3) per silo. Or you can build 5 silos with 7 beacons each. You can't get it down to 3 silos (in vanilla), because the maximum number of beacons you can fit around a silo is 20 and that's still not quite fast enough to launch a rocket per minute in each silo.

Spidertron: Do the exoskeleton speed bonus stack? Are there any diminishing returns?

Re: Simple Questions and Short Answers

Posted: Mon Feb 22, 2021 8:43 pm
by Khagan
Latakia wrote:
Mon Feb 22, 2021 7:57 pm
Spidertron: Do the exoskeleton speed bonus stack? Are there any diminishing returns?
The bonuses add. The fact that they add instead of multiplying is an implicit diminishing return.
